sql money數(shù)據(jù)在進(jìn)行運(yùn)算時(shí)需注意什么

sql
小樊
82
2024-08-22 06:28:27
欄目: 云計(jì)算

在進(jìn)行運(yùn)算時(shí),SQL Money數(shù)據(jù)類(lèi)型需要注意以下幾點(diǎn):

  1. 精度丟失:由于Money數(shù)據(jù)類(lèi)型是固定精度和固定小數(shù)點(diǎn)的數(shù)據(jù)類(lèi)型,可能會(huì)導(dǎo)致在進(jìn)行運(yùn)算時(shí)出現(xiàn)精度丟失的情況,因此需要謹(jǐn)慎處理結(jié)果的精度。

  2. 舍入誤差:在進(jìn)行小數(shù)點(diǎn)計(jì)算時(shí),可能會(huì)出現(xiàn)舍入誤差,導(dǎo)致計(jì)算結(jié)果不準(zhǔn)確,因此需要注意對(duì)計(jì)算結(jié)果進(jìn)行四舍五入或者向上取整等處理。

  3. 數(shù)據(jù)溢出:在進(jìn)行運(yùn)算時(shí),如果計(jì)算結(jié)果超出Money數(shù)據(jù)類(lèi)型的范圍,可能會(huì)導(dǎo)致數(shù)據(jù)溢出的情況,因此需要確保計(jì)算結(jié)果不會(huì)超出Money數(shù)據(jù)類(lèi)型的范圍。

  4. 數(shù)據(jù)類(lèi)型轉(zhuǎn)換:在進(jìn)行Money數(shù)據(jù)類(lèi)型的運(yùn)算時(shí),需要注意數(shù)據(jù)類(lèi)型的轉(zhuǎn)換問(wèn)題,確保數(shù)據(jù)類(lèi)型一致,避免出現(xiàn)錯(cuò)誤的計(jì)算結(jié)果。

總之,在進(jìn)行Money數(shù)據(jù)類(lèi)型的運(yùn)算時(shí),需要謹(jǐn)慎處理數(shù)據(jù)精度、舍入誤差、數(shù)據(jù)溢出和數(shù)據(jù)類(lèi)型轉(zhuǎn)換等問(wèn)題,以確保計(jì)算結(jié)果的準(zhǔn)確性和可靠性。

0